原文:【原创】threejs实现一个全景地球

介绍 本demo实现一个旋转的全景地球,效果如下 技术分析 .球体 .球体表面贴图 实现 创建容器 引入js文件 主体部分 核心部分 threejs api的链接:https: threejs.org docs index.html Manual Introduction Creating a scene 线上效果:http: htmlpreview.github.io https: github ...

2017-01-06 16:14 0 4994 推荐指数:

查看详情

threejs实现三维全景

网络上看到了3D全景图,发现threejs里面有一个库竟然可以实现,一下我贴出代码: ...

Sat Mar 07 21:19:00 CST 2020 1 8793
使用 React 和 Threejs 创建一个VR全景项目

最近我在学习使用 React 配合 Three.js 来搭建一个可以浏览720全景图片的项目 实现的是加载一张 2:1 的720全景 分享一下我的创建过程 一、搭建框架并安装需要的插件 二、创建 Pano 组件 Pano 组件用来加载720全景图 三、将 Pano 组件 ...

Mon Aug 17 08:14:00 CST 2020 0 1389
ThreeJS 高亮地球

环境 ThreeJS 107版本 three.min.js OrbitControls.js 说明 网上地球高亮和辉光的效果很多,这里用GLSL做(没学明白,网上东拼西凑拿来用了)。还有尝试过用Render渲染,但是render生成的canvas会覆盖整个浏览器窗口 ...

Thu May 21 17:45:00 CST 2020 0 632
ThreeJS 地球上撒点

环境 ThreeJS 107版本 three.min.js OrbitControls.js 说明 撒点功能原理是在地球上根据坐标批量加上圆对象,可以设置颜色和球大小。 解决方案 创建球的过程参见"ThreeJS制作地球" 创建点group,考虑后面 ...

Thu May 21 17:41:00 CST 2020 0 593
ThreeJS 地球上添加标注

环境 ThreeJS 107版本 three.min.js OrbitControls.js 说明 添加标注的原理是利用在场景中添加canvas实现,要标注的文字绘制在canvas中。 解决方案 创建球的过程参见"ThreeJS制作地球" 创建点 ...

Thu May 21 17:42:00 CST 2020 1 2338
ThreeJS 制作地球

环境 ThreeJS 107版本 three.min.js OrbitControls.js 深空背景图片 大小4036*1808 地球贴图 大小2048*1024 边幅以东西经180度为界限 说明 原本我们GIS使用的是cesiumJS开发的三维 ...

Thu May 21 17:35:00 CST 2020 0 1696
threejs创建地球

上个月底,在朋友圈看到一个号称“这可能是地球上最美的h5”的分享,点进入后发现这个h5还很别致,思考了一会,决定要不高仿一个? 到今天为止,高仿基本完成, 线上地址 github地址 除了手机端的media控制没有去兼容,其他的基本都给仿了。 那为了让你觉得是高仿,最好 ...

Mon Mar 09 05:33:00 CST 2020 3 2959
 
粤ICP备18138465号  © 2018-2025 CODEPRJ.COM